About The Position

As a GenAI CBRNE & Cyber Red Team Expert, you'll adversarially test and strengthen the safety guardrails of GenAI systems against high-risk cyber threats - with a particular focus on industrial hacking, SCADA systems, ICS/OT environments, and CBRNE domains. Drawing on deep industrial cybersecurity expertise (hands-on familiarity with SCADA, Modbus, DNP3, and PLC exploits) alongside CBRNE domain knowledge and advanced AI red-teaming skills, you'll design sophisticated adversarial prompts, multi-turn attack scenarios, jailbreaks, and model evaluations to determine when GenAI systems could materially enable physical-world industrial attacks or cyber-enabled CBRNE threats. The role calls for an adversarial mindset: thinking like a malicious actor to find ways AI systems could be manipulated, combining seemingly benign information across interactions, circumventing safeguards, or exploiting model behavior to extract sensitive cyber-CBRNE information.

Responsibilities

  • Run rigorous red-teaming of GenAI models across SCADA, ICS, and CBRNE scenarios. You will be probing for safeguard bypasses, dangerous capability escalation, and unintended disclosure of sensitive OT information.
  • Design adversarial prompts, jailbreaks, and multi-turn evaluations against industrial hacking scenarios (SCADA, PLCs, DCS, Modbus/DNP3/IEC 60870-5-104/Ethernet-IP, critical infrastructure, hazardous-material facilities).
  • Evaluate whether models can be manipulated into assisting attacks via payload generation, ladder logic exploitation, reconnaissance, or aggregating benign inputs into high-risk workflows.
  • Document failure modes (obfuscation, role-play, decomposition, escalation), classify severity, and report findings to safety/alignment teams.
  • Build repeatable test suites, adversarial datasets, and risk taxonomies; stay current on GenAI attack techniques and CBRNE/critical-infrastructure threats.
